Abstract: A manufacturing machine for sagged self-supporting cable includes a turntable and a drive member for imparting rotation to the turntable. Several die casting members include molds designed to selectively open and close. The die casting member are circumferentially mounted on the turntable. A mold assemblying member is provided for selectively opening and closing the molds. A sag adjusting device is mounted on the turntable for adjusting the position of a main cable so as to be longer between adjacent die cast members than a suspension wire. An injection device is disposed adjacent to a crimping point and moves synchronously with the die casting member for filling the mold cavity with the crimping material for securing the relative positioning of a main cable relative to a suspension wire.
